Digital visual management refers to the use of digital tools and platforms to display and track key metrics, workflows, tasks, and progress within an organization. It provides real-time insights into processes and performance, helping teams and managers stay aligned, make informed decisions, and ensure that goals are met. While traditional visual management methods like whiteboards, sticky notes, and physical Kanban boards have been effective in many organizations, digital visual management takes this concept to the next level by offering advanced features, such as automation, remote access, and integration with other software platforms.
